About the author

Critic, novelist, literary historian, and dramatist Kato Shuichi is Guest Professor of International Relations, Ritsumeikan University. He is author of many works, including a three-volume History of Japanese Literature (1979-83) and Form, Style, Tradition: Reflections on Japanese Art and Society (1971) and coauthor of Six Lives, Six Deaths: Portraits from Modern Japan (1979). Chia-ning Chang is Associate Professor of Japanese Literature at the University of California, Davis.

Summary

An autobiography of Kato Shuichi, a cultural critic, literary historian, novelist, poet, and physician. It reconstructs his spiritual and intellectual journey from the militarist era of prewar Japan to the dynamic postwar landscapes of Japan and Europe. It interprets modern Japan and its tumultuous relations with the outside world.
